I just received my new wheels for the HD. I want to polish them really good before I put them on, just to make sure they have a good protective coating on them until next time I clean them.

 

:D What is the best polish aluminum wheel cleaner and polish you can use? What type of cloth is use to buff the wheel without leaving too much swirl?

Posted

I thought these wheels were plastic coated. If they are, I wouldn't polish them with anything abrasive.

 

As far as wheel cleaners go, I had really good luck with Westley's Hot Rims. It's supposed to be safe for all wheels, plastic coated or not, or painted.

I always have used Mothers Mag and Wheel polish with a soft cotton terry towel. Then I follow that up with a nice thick coat of regular wax. The wax is what really helps keep the break dust and dirt off of them.

 

The detailing board is saying that RejeX is great for wheels if you wanna go as far as buying it. It's advertised for the whole car, but they are very particular about their shine, but say it last forever on wheels. Here's the webpage for it:
